A mount for the Omron Platinum Blood Pressure (BP5450) machine that can either make wall mounting easier, or allow for placement under a desk.  Should work on the Gold (BP5350) machine as well, it appears to use the same chassis.  May work on others, but I have not attempted it.  Allows for easy removal of the machine if needing to be portable in both wall and under desk options. If wall mounting, the MainPart file can be used as a drill guide for screws the proper size to fit the machine, or can be attached to the wall in the same manner it attaches to the Brackets for a slightly better fit.If under desk mounting, simply print out all parts and use the HolesTemplate file to mark where you want the screws to go, it's about a 2-3 minute print.  Either screw the Brackets to the desk first for easier access to the screws, or fully assemble the mount for slightly easier alignment. I used some small sticky velcro things to hold the arm band behind the machine, but it could be draped over and around it as well. I designed it to work with M4 screws and nuts, but can be modified via available .STEP files to whatever you need.I went with multiple parts for ease of printing and modularity but if you are confident enough in your printer you can save some screws and do them all together. However, I do not have a file for that readily available and should be simple enough to modify in a CAD program of your choice. I include both individual and complete STEP files, as well as STL. I printed everything at 0.2mm height with PETG, and needed to slightly sand or pre-screw some of the holes to make it easier to assemble. A tuned printer should handle it fine.  Brackets were printed on their sides, everything else with a flat portion touching the build plate.  Supports were sparsely used for the holes, may or may not be necessary with your printer or filament of choice. Printed Bill of Materials:2 Bracket1 MainPart2 ScrewAdapter1 HoleTemplateNon-Printed Bill of Materials and Tools required:4 M4 nuts and screws (can be longer and still work, but I believe I used 8 or 10mm ones)4 standard screws that are adequate for what you are attaching it to. (I used small wood screws for a cheap wooden desk and it seems to work fine)Hex Key for M4 screws (comes with some printers)Screwdriver/Drill/Driver that match your mounting preference (Thicker shafts may be difficult to fit through the Bracket, which has ~6mm holes to access the screws)Pen Amazon link (unaffiliated) to the Machinehttps://a.co/d/9uRd7Yi
